Gyðja Lv 3VIII (Ǫrv 63 [a])
Margaret Clunies Ross (ed.) 2017, ‘Ǫrvar-Odds saga 63 (Gyðja, Lausavísur 3)’ in Margaret Clunies Ross (ed.), Poetry in fornaldarsögur. Skaldic Poetry of the Scandinavian Middle Ages 8. Turnhout: Brepols, p. 878.
Hverir ólu þik upp svá heimskan,
er þú eigi vill Óðin blóta?
Hverir ólu þik upp svá heimskan, er þú vill eigi blóta Óðin?
Which people brought you up so stupid that you are not willing to sacrifice to Óðinn?

Context: See Introduction to stanzas 59-70. Stanza 63ab is a dialogue between Gyðja and Oddr. Lines 1-4 (Ǫrv 63a) are introduced with the words þá kvað hon ‘then she said’, while lines 5-8 (Ǫrv 63b) are Oddr’s reply, beginning þá kvað Oddr ‘then Oddr said’.
Notes: [All]: Stanzas 63ab-70 are not
present in ms. 7, although two pairs of lines from sts 61 and 62 in 7 are
variants of parts of sts 66 and 69 in the other mss.
